WebFREQUENCY OF OSCILLATION x WAVELENGTH = SPEED OF LIGHT We can use this relationship to figure out the wavelength or frequency of any electromagnetic wave if we have the other measurement. Just divide the speed of light by whichever measurement you have and then you've got the other.
